Cyclone Fengal: EMU train services restored in all sections

The Chennai division of SR received more than 100 calls in the helpline numbers on Saturday. “Most number of calls were about train enquiries and stations that were waterlogged,” the official added.

CHENNAI: Train services that were halted and diverted due to the cyclone-induced heavy rains were restored by Sunday morning.

“The engineering department of Southern Railway cleared the excess water from the tracks and stations. Technical and non-technical teams also addressed issues like fallen shelters in the stations due to strong wind, which helped in restoring the services quickly,” said an official attached to the Chennai division of SR.

The suburban train services in the MRTS route between Beach and Velachery were suspended on Saturday noon. In the Beach-Tambaram section, trains were terminated at Pallavaram and from Chengalpattu to Vandalur due to the rains. These were later restored.
